Day 1 Alice Springs –
Uluru Sacred Sites & Sunset
The camel was a vital animal in
the history and development of
the Australian outback. Visit a
camel farm – perhaps even take
a ride on one of these so-called
‘ships of the desert’ – and see
towering Atila (Mt. Conner) today
as you make your way to Ayers
Rock Resort. View the amazing
collection of Indigenous paintings
at the Uluru-Kata Tjuta Cultural
Centre, then tour the base of Uluru
with your expert Driver Guide.
Continue to the Kuniya Walk, and
Uluru
the sacred Mutitjulu Waterhole. In
the late afternoon, experience the
remarkable color changes of Uluru
as the sun sets over the world’s
largest monolith. Hotel: Outback
Pioneer Hotel (B), Desert Gardens
Hotel (R) or Sails in the Desert
Hotel (S), Ayers Rock Resort.

Day 2 Uluru Sunrise –
Kings Canyon
Witness a magnificent Uluru
sunrise, then continue to the
36 domes of Kata Tjuta (the
Olgas). On the way enjoy
panoramic views on the south
side of Kata Tjuta from the
dune viewing platform. Explore
Walpa Gorge and the unusual
conglomerate rock formations.
This afternoon, travel to Kings
Canyon. Hotel: Standard Rooms
(B & R) or Deluxe Spa Rooms
(S), Kings Canyon Resort. D
Day 3 Kings Canyon –
Depart Alice Springs
Join a guided climb to the rim
of Kings Canyon for marvellous
views of Watarrka National Park,
or take an easier walk along the
boulder-strewn creek bed of
the canyon. Your Short Break
concludes back in Alice Springs.

Day 1 Alice Springs –
Uluru Sacred Sites & Sunset
Traveling south though red desert
country, you’ll stop to visit a camel
farm and learn about the vital
role these hardy animals played
in the development of Central
Australia. Later, stop to view Atila
(Mt. Conner), often mistaken for
Uluru, before arriving at Ayers Rock
Resort. This afternoon join your
Driver Guide for a tour around the
base of Uluru, then continue to the
Kuniya Walk and visit the sacred
Mutitjulu Waterhole. View ancient
rock art and learn about the
Aboriginal and European history
of the area, and spend some time
at the Uluru-Kata Tjuta Cultural
Centre where you’ll gain some
fascinating cultural insights. In the
late afternoon, witness the striking
color changes of Uluru (Ayers
Rock) at sunset as you enjoy
sparkling wine at the prime sunset
viewing area. Hotel: Outback
Pioneer Hotel (B), Desert Gardens
Hotel (R) or Sails in the Desert
Hotel (S), Ayers Rock Resort.

Day 2 Uluru –
Kings Canyon –
Depart Alice Springs
Drive through deserted sandhill
country towards Kings Canyon,
stopping for a breakfast at Kings
Creek Station. Climb to the rim of
the canyon for marvellous views
of Watarrka National Park, or
enjoy a more leisurely 1½ hour
walk along the boulder-strewn
creek bed of the canyon. Later
travel to Alice Springs, where
your Short Break concludes. B
